VIETNAM : Memories of Te^’t or Lunar New YearThe twenty fourth of January of the year 2001 is a special occasion for the Vietnamese because it is the first day of Tet or New Year's Day in the Lunar calendar, This year is the year of the snake. I always think of Tet with so much excitement, because it is the time when I could get a lot of money from the Tie^`n Li` Xi` , eat a lot of special foods, and almost never get into any troubles. The money for Good Luck (Tie^`n Li` Xi`) usually come in small rectangular red envelopes, with gold letters and inside, we usually find brand new, fresh smelling and crisp piastre bills, the best part is that we could spend and buy anything we want with this money, without ever having to check with our parents. I remember clutching those bills in my hands and thinking of a thousand things I could buy with this gift. Tet is the only time we could eat whatever we want on the display tables so long as we do not touch the foods until after the ancestral offering. Oh these special "Banh Chung, the square cakes, wrapped in a banana leaf, symbol of earth and heaven, are quite delicious. We love watching them being cooked in huge cylindrical barrels for at least twelve to fourteen hours. With pickled Cu? Kie^.u or Leeks, they always taste so much better. Then there is the sweet smell of fresh fruits, the custard apples or ma?ng ca^`u, red papayas or ddu-ddu?, mangoes or xoa`i, watermelons or du?a ha^'u, and bananas or chuo^'i. We also eat different types of candied fruits. I always find the candied ginger or mu?t gu?`ng and the candies coconut strips (mu?'t du?`a ) the best, the lotus seeds are also quite delectable. But I don't like the dried dates (tra'i cha`la`) as they are too sweet for my taste. I love the house with its walls freshly painted, its floor cleanly swept and different rooms adorned with beautiful flowers everywhere. The red roses, pink carnations, white lilies, purple and white gladioli and in the main living room, a huge potted apricot tree with its delicate yellow blossoms, which supposedly, brings us good luck in the coming new year. Tet is such a wonderful time for family and friends. Everyone has a chance to get away from the hustle and bustle of everyday living.
